The strength of the tubes go down by nearly an order of magnitude
because of imperfection in the crystal. a perfect crytal is a helical
tube. during growth a second helix starts growing at site in on the
tube and the interweaving of two helices starts. This creates strain
in the tube. The imperfection I describe is thermodynamicaly stable so
there is no way to stop it from happening. It was first observed in
England on tubes much smaller than 1/2 mm.
